Joint Custody Agreement

1. Parties: Identification of both parents/guardians, their current addresses, and relationship to the child(ren)
2. Background: Brief history of the relationship, marriage/separation status, and current custody situation
3. Definitions: Clear definitions of terms used throughout the agreement, including 'joint custody', 'physical custody', 'legal custody', etc.
4. Child Information: Details of the child(ren) covered by the agreement, including full names, ages, and current residences
5. Custody Arrangements: Specification of joint custody terms, including legal and physical custody arrangements
6. Residential Schedule: Detailed schedule of where the child(ren) will reside, including regular weekly schedule and transitions
7. Decision Making Rights: Distribution of decision-making authority regarding education, healthcare, religion, and other major life aspects
8. Communication Protocol: Rules for communication between parents and with the child(ren), including methods and frequency
9. Financial Responsibilities: Allocation of expenses, child support arrangements, and cost-sharing mechanisms
10. Dispute Resolution: Process for resolving disagreements and making modifications to the agreement
11. Governing Law: Statement that the agreement is governed by Philippine law and relevant statutes
12. Execution: Signature blocks, notarization requirements, and date of agreement
1. International Travel Arrangements: Include when either parent lives abroad or frequent international travel is anticipated
2. Educational Arrangements: Include when specific arrangements for school choice and educational decisions need to be detailed
3. Religious Upbringing: Include when parents have different religious beliefs or specific religious education is planned
4. Medical Care Provisions: Include when child has specific medical needs or when parents have specific healthcare preferences
5. Extended Family Access: Include when arrangements for grandparents or other family members' access needs to be specified
6. Special Needs Provisions: Include when child has special needs requiring specific care arrangements
7. Language and Cultural Provisions: Include in cases of cross-cultural families or when maintaining specific cultural identity is important
8. Social Media and Privacy: Include when specific agreements about sharing children's information online are needed
1. Schedule A - Residential Calendar: Detailed calendar showing regular living arrangements, including school terms and holidays
2. Schedule B - Holiday Schedule: Specific arrangements for national holidays, school breaks, and special occasions
3. Schedule C - Transportation Arrangements: Details of pick-up/drop-off locations, times, and responsible parties
4. Schedule D - Contact Information: List of important contact details including parents, schools, doctors, and emergency contacts
5. Schedule E - Expense Allocation: Detailed breakdown of regular and extraordinary expenses and their allocation
6. Appendix 1 - Medical Information: Child(ren)'s medical history, insurance information, and emergency procedures
7. Appendix 2 - Education Information: School details, academic records, and educational requirements
8. Appendix 3 - Communication Log Template: Template for recording important communications between parents regarding the child(ren)
